Hysteresis Performance and Restoring-Force Model of Precast Concrete Ring-Lap Beam-Column Joints
In order to study the restoring-force characteristics of precast concrete ring-lap beam-column joints, three precast concrete ring-lap beam-column joint specimens and one cast-in-place concrete beam-column joint specimen were designed and fabricated, and low-circumferential repeated loading tests we...
